Emergency Roadside Service Technician

CAA Atlantic

CAA Atlantic is currently seeking an experienced Emergency Roadside Service Technician for our Moncton, New Brunswick location. As an Emergency Roadside Assistance Technician, you will be responsible for delivering prompt and effective roadside support our CAA members who are experiencing vehicle breakdowns, accidents, or other emergencies. This role involves identifying vehicle issues, performing on-scene services, and towing. This role presents the opportunity to support and work with our members on a daily basis. To date in 2024, CAA Atlantic has serviced over 100,000 Emergency Roadside Service calls!

This position follows a shift rotation schedule. The selected candidate would be required to work 7 days on 7 days off, the hours of operation are 7:00AM – 8:00PM. There is possibility of some travel outside of the Moncton region to service members across New Brunswick or in Prince Edward Island. This position is commencing immediately.

Responsibilities

  • Tire changes
  • Lock-outs
  • Battery delivery/replacement/boosts
  • Fuel delivery
  • Towing
  • So much more

Qualifications

  • Able to work 7 days on 7 days off. Shift hours: 7:00AM – 8:00PM
  • Exceptional commitment to customer service
  • Commitment to working as part of a team
  • Ability to work unsupervised and in difficult conditions
  • Ability to work in all weather conditions
  • Relevant work experience in Customer Service and / or Automotive related experience
  • Strong mechanical aptitude preferred but not essential
  • Class 5 Licence with Air Brake Endorsements, preferred but not required
  • Bilingualism considered an asset
